Abstract

This article examines the design of a dual-readout 23-bit digital angle transducer (DAT) with two-phase inductance pickups providing coarse and fine angle readings. The transducer is described mathematically and the results of tests of several prototype 22- and 23- bit DATs with different precise-reading angle sensors are reported.
